Alliance University, also known as AU, is a private university established in 2010. Located in Bengaluru, Karnataka, the Alliance University campus spans over 60 acres. The university is recognised by the University Grants Commission (UGC) and accredited by the National Board of Accreditation (NBA) and the International Accreditation Council for Business Education (IACBE). Alliance University is ranked 39th by NIRF under the Management category in 2024.
Alliance University off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, diploma, and doctorate programs in streams such as Engineering, Management, Law, Commerce, Arts, and Design. BTech, MBA, BBA, BA LLB, and BCom are some of the popular courses. Admissions at Alliance University are based on entrance examinations. The university accepts AUAT, JEE Main, and Karnataka CET for BTech; AUAT, CAT, XAT, and NMAT for MBA; AUAT and CLAT for BA LLB; and AUAT for BBA and BCom.
For placements, Alliance University’s placement rate is approximately 90% (based on available data). During the placement drive of 2024, the highest salary package offered was INR 36 LPA, and the average package stood at INR 8 LPA.

The Ministry of Education (MoE) has released the NIRF Ranking 2025. As per the rankings, Alliance University, Bengaluru has been ranked in both the Management and Law categories. In terms of category-wise rankings, the Alliance University NIRF Ranking 2025 is 71st position in Management with a score of 49.85, and 20th position in Law with a score of 60.83.

The Alliance University provides the staff and students on the campus with top-notch amenities spread across more than 55 acres of land. The campus's infrastructure and facilities are state-of-the-art, with well-stocked classrooms and cutting-edge learning tools. The institution offers student housing halls that provide a safe and welcoming setting. In order to quickly answer the day-to-day concerns of the hostel inhabitants, there is a residential warden and assistants in each hall of residence, who are under the supervision of a head warden and the hostel administration. The Halls of Residence include single, double, or triple-sharing rooms with 24/7 internet connectivity for students. The availability of the rooms is determined by "first-come, first-served."
